APPLETON (WLUK) -- Fox Valley Technical College is launching a new program to get more truck drivers on the road.
The initiative is training refugees and under-represented populations to earn a commercial driver's license.
The college started this after receiving a $1.67 million grant from the state.
The money is focused on getting long-term unemployed people to work.
"I have a husband who's a truck driver, and I used to go with him, so I've seen that, how he works, and sometimes, I see the challenge," said Asha Hirsi.
"I cannot wait to get behind the wheel. I think it would be a very exciting day."
The program started with 25 applicants, but officials may expand it because of high demand.
